How to fill out the Fema Property Information Form 2002 online

Completing the Fema Property Information Form 2002 is crucial for obtaining benefits related to flood insurance and property assessment. This guide will provide a clear, step-by-step process to assist users in filling out the form online effectively.

Follow the steps to complete the Fema Property Information Form 2002 online.

  1. Press the ‘Get Form’ button to access the form and open it in your editor.
  2. Enter the street address of the property in the designated field. If the request pertains to multiple structures, please attach an additional sheet for clarity.
  3. Provide the legal description of the property, including the Lot, Block, and Subdivision details, if the street address is unavailable.
  4. Indicate whether you are requesting the removal of the Special Flood Hazard Area (SFHA) designation for the entire property, a portion of the property, or specific structures. Choose the appropriate option available.
  5. State if this request is for a single structure, single lot, multiple structures, or multiple lots, and specify the number involved in your request.
  6. If applicable, check whether fill has been placed on your property, and provide the date of placement or the anticipated date if it will occur.
  7. Compile all required additional documents, such as the Plat Map, property Deed, effective Flood Insurance Rate Map (FIRM), and the relevant elevation forms. Ensure these documents are accurately prepared as they support your request.
  8. Review the processing fees applicable to your request and include the Payment Information Form if necessary. Confirm that you have selected the correct fee based on your submission type.
  9. Complete your details as the applicant, including your name, company, mailing address, and contact information.
  10. Sign and date the application form to confirm that all the information provided is correct to the best of your knowledge.
  11. Once all sections are completed, save your changes, and then proceed to download, print, or share the form as required.

The Standard Flood Hazard Determination Form (SFHDF) is used to assess whether a property is located in a Special Flood Hazard Area (SFHA). This form is crucial for lenders and property owners as it dictates the flood insurance requirements for the property.
